Male Brow vs. Female Brow

There are important differences between the anatomy of male versus female patients that are crucial to properly tailoring the procedure and achieving a high-caliber result. A natural male brow is generally flatter and lower, resting at or just above the orbital rim, with less arch. More traditional brow lift techniques developed with an arched or elevated aesthetic in mind can create results that look “off” when this ideal is applied to men seeking a brow lift. Men also contend with hairline recession in a way that requires careful incision planning to ensure natural aesthetics. A skilled facial plastic surgeon adjusts the procedure to preserve a masculine brow line rather than defaulting to a one-size-fits-all elevation.

Conservative Brow Lift Techniques for Men

While it’s tempting to think that a greater degree of “lift” can signify a more noticeable and youthful result, avoiding overcorrection and maintaining a conservative approach are paramount. Brows that are raised too high can create startled or “windswept” expressions, often portraying telltale signs of surgery. The forehead skin may appear unnaturally tight, and one’s natural expression lines may flatten out in a way that looks stiff rather than seamless. A more conservative lift, often just a few millimeters, tends to produce a result that reads as rested and natural without drawing attention to itself.

With modern endoscopic brow lift techniques, small incisions and a camera-guided approach are utilized. This tends to offer more precise, gradual adjustments than older methods that rely on larger incisions and more aggressive tissue removal. This precision allows excellent surgical accuracy and control, which makes it easier to avoid an artificial appearance. 

On the other hand, for men already considering a hair transplant, a Pretrichial Brow Lift with Forehead Reduction by Hairline Advancement is a very beneficial procedure. This type of brow lift can give the patient an amazing headstart because its hairline lowering is already the equivalent of a few hair transplant procedures. One more hair transplant can then be done to camouflage the scar. Therefore, a Pretrichial Brow Lift and Upper Blepharoplasty is the most powerful combination procedure to rejuvenate the upper-third of the face. 

Communication and Expectations

Beyond the surgery itself, patient-surgeon communication plays a big role in outcomes. Men should feel comfortable being explicit about wanting a subtle, natural-looking change rather than a dramatic one. Discussing specific concerns and asking how a prospective surgeon tailors their brow lifts for male anatomy can help set realistic expectations before any decisions are made.
